Suarez: Barcelona are still ahead of Real Madrid

Luis Suarez believes that the fact Barcelona are still on top of La Liga shows they are ahead of Real Madrid, despite losing in El Clasico on Saturday evening.

Goals from Cristiano Ronaldo, Pepe and Karim Benzema cancelled out Neymar’s early opener for the Barcelona, seeing them lose their first league game of the season and concede their first, second and third goals.

Uruguayan striker Suarez made his debut for Barcelona in the game and performed well, and despite the defeat he has remained confident that his side can maintain their lead ahead of Madrid.

“We need to think about this match but we are still one point ahead of Real Madrid and we have to go on,” the 27-year-old told reporters after the game.

“Due to the intensity of the match I knew I was not going to play the full 90 minutes.

“I had not spoken with the coach about how long I would play. I heard I would start during the tactical talk an hour and a half before the game.

“For these late few weeks I have trained every day thinking about this match and I felt ready to play. The coach took the decision and I was available. I felt good and I tried to do everything in my power to help my team.

“You always want to mark your debut with a win and the result was not good for us considering the occasion, but I gave my all.”

Barcelona will welcome Celta Vigo to Camp Nou next Saturday.
